- The distance between Woomera, Australia and San Juan, Dominican Republic is approximately 16,889 km or 10,495 mi.
- To reach Woomera in this distance one would set out from San Juan bearing 238.5°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Woomera bearing 289.4° or WNW .
- Woomera has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as San Juan has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Woomera is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as San Juan is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 5.6 °C (10.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.5 °C (20.7°F) more in Woomera.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 753.9 mm (29.7 in) less which is equivalent to 753.9 l/m² (18.5 US gal/ft²) or 7,539,000 l/ha (805,969 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.7° lower in Woomera than in San Juan.
